Product Description
Mid-telephoto macro lenses give photographers a boost to creativity and a versatile working distance, which makes the lenses a favorite among professionals as part of their basic gear. Introduced as the first macro lens for mirrorless cameras in the Art line of lenses for mirrorless cameras, the 105mm F2.8 DG DN MACRO | Art packs the highest level of performance expected of a mid-telephoto macro lens into its body, from its superb optical performance to excellent build quality.

There are only a few other downsides and I can easily look past those given what it can do. Like others have said, the autofocus isn’t as perfect as the rest of this package. This is due to the noise it produces(not a huge issue for me) and because it’s not as speedy as some other lens. Manual focus works great though and Sonys DMF focus setting also works great if you wanna quickly try to autofocus then adjust manually to make sure you have your shot in perfect focus.
Overall I am extremely pleased with this lens and love finding new ways to use it. Also be aware that it can do much more than close up macro shots and portraits. I was surprised at the versatility of this lens and the variety of different shots I could create with the 105mm focal length.
Side note: One of the top reviews says you can’t change the aperature within your camera. That is not true. Just leave the aperature ring on the “A” setting and the camera can control it (which is what I prefer).

First impression - This lens is pretty dope. I currently am an event photographer and I realized there's one lens that was missing from my arsenal and that was a macro lens. I am a Sony shooter and prefer native Sony lenses when it comes to Zooms and primes but I will tell you this Sigma Art Lenses are NO JOKE. They are great quality, provide great color, very fast. And they are slowly filling up my camera bags.
It took about 5 days for this lens to arrive. Once I got it and examined it I noticed the build quality was excellent. The focus ring and aperture ring are placed differently and one thing I noticed I have to always adjust the aperture ring, it's not adjustable within camera you have to manually adjust with lens. This is entirely new to me. It takes some getting used to. But once you do you are off to the races.
I do not see myself using this lens as a permanent mainstay on my camera. It's there to serve a specific purpose - Macro shots, portraits that need extremely sharp focus. This lens will not serves it's best benefit to use as a walkaround lens. But if you need a macro - This lens is a great alternative to the Sony 90mm. Just know, it will take some getting used to to adjust the focus and aperture ring.
Pros
Excellently priced
Specialty lens
Very sharp
Short focusing distance
Focus speed is pretty decent (depending on what you're focusing on)
Cons
Unable to adjust aperture within camera. Not too crazy about that. Must be done thru the lens
